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
056971786 8479 38612 26097
8813 51562
8813 51562
00896 9328170 28848
All about undefined
Interested in learning more?
8813 51562
00896 9328170 28848
See more
660037608 8905963824
93246158 074454228 836
See more
7914559 58480058195 2746
0101 7308309072 26458480
See more